  1. Dictionary
    Pes·si·mis·tic
    /ˌpesəˈmistik/

    adjective

    • 1. tending to see the worst aspect of things or believe that the worst will happen: "he was pessimistic about the prospects"

  3. Pessimistic describes the state of mind of someone who always expects the worst. A pessimistic attitude isn't very hopeful, shows little optimism, and can be a downer for everyone else. To be pessimistic means you believe evil outweighs the good and that bad things are more likely to happen.

  6. 1. : an inclination to emphasize adverse aspects, conditions, and possibilities or to expect the worst possible outcome. 2. a. : the doctrine that reality is essentially evil. b. : the doctrine that evil overbalances happiness in life. Examples of pessimism in a Sentence. Although the economy shows signs of improving, a sense of pessimism remains.
